4 In Memorandum It is with great sadness that we say goodbye to long time blood donor and volunteer, Richard Julian. Richard passed away on August 30 th. He began volunteering with SDBB in 2002 working as a regular canteen host at the donor center on Upas Street, and at blood drives and special events.. In addition to his volunteer work, Richard was a long time blood donor, donating more than 57 gallons throughout his lifetime. Fellow long-time volunteer Larry Jarmon recalls, Richard was a terrific worker and wonderful volunteer with a pleasant personality. He always had something nice to say. He and I were one of the first community donors back in the late 70 s and we received our 10 gallon hats together. A blood drive in honor of Richard is scheduled for Sunday, October 24, from 8am to 1pm at Pacific Christian Church at 1074 Loring Street in Pacific Beach. The 2010/2011 High School Blood Drive season kicks off in September! If you are looking for a Canteen Host opportunity near you and not available at your local donor center, please consider signing up at one of our many high school blood drives this year. Canteen Hosts are critical to these busy but fun blood drives. The Canteen Host monitors the student blood donors for reactions after the donation. In addition, the volunteer assists the Collection Staff by keeping them focused on the donation process and involved with the student donors. or call Noemí today to sign up!
